What does the French word laissez-faire mean?

Literally, that means "let it be". A+ =" Let the people do as they choose " It means "allow to do" It is a government policy in which intervention of government is strongly opposed. That policy aims to create an environment in which transactions between private parties are free from state intervention, including restrictive regulations, taxes, tariffs and enforced monopolies.

Doctrine of estate in land law?

The doctrine of estate in land law refers to the different types of ownership interests or rights that an individual can have in real property. These interests include fee simple, life estates, and leasehold estates. Each estate has its own set of rights and limitations concerning the use and transfer of the property.
